But when a wayward English lass interrupts his revenge, he loses his enemy in the dark. Now, her compelled testimony could send Broderick back to the prison that nearly killed him. Unless they find a loophole -- an inconvenient, shockingly tempting loophole. For Kate Huxley, visiting her brother in the Scottish Highlands is a blissful escape from the stifling expectations of the marriage mart. Blissful, that is, until a scarred, beastly Highlander with a heart-breaking past frightens her out of her wits, making her a witness in a criminal inquiry. Kate has no wish to testify against a man who's already suffered too much. But the only remedy is to become his wife. And she can't possibly marry such a surly, damaged man, can she? Well, perhaps. If it means she can stay in her beloved Scotland.
